Analysis
The most recent figure for proportion of qualified teachers in pre-primary education, adjusted in WB: Low Income (july 2025) is 1.29 GPIA,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of up 0.3% on the previous year and down 5.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of qualified teachers in pre-primary education, adjusted in WB: Low Income (july 2025) peaked at 1.36 GPIA in 2014 and was at its lowest, 1 GPIA, in 2020.
WB: Low Income (july 2025) ranks 23rd of 151 groups on this measure, in the top quarter.
